## Deployment

The Bannerline consent banner rolls out via the Oakridge edge config, not an app release. Push a new config version, wait for edge propagation (~5 min), verify in an incognito session. Rollback is a config revert; never hotfix the bundle directly. Regions gate independently — enable one at a time and watch opt-in rates for anomalies before proceeding. Each environment reads the settings below at startup.

config for kafof-bawef:
holath:
  log_level: debug
  metrics_host: metrics.holath.qorvelsys.internal
  pin: 2191
  pool_size: 32

## Limits and Quotas

If your plugin ships telemetry through the Pulsegrid ingest pipe, payloads get compressed before they count against your quota — so yes, a chatty plugin can sneak under the limit if its data compresses well. Don't rely on that, though: the broker measures post-compression size with a hard cap, and oversized frames are dropped silently (check the rejection counter). Batching small events into one frame almost always beats sending them individually. The thresholds currently enforced on the Harlow cluster are below.

tuning table, faweg-bajep:
WEIGHTS = {
    "belius": 690,
    "eliox": 458,
    "norax": 616,
    "praion": 132,
    "zorvan": 911,
}

**Runbook: Audit-log viewer — Ferrowatch**

If folks report the Ferrowatch audit-log viewer showing stale entries, it's almost always the indexer lagging, not data loss. Check the indexer lag metric first — under 5 minutes is fine, just wait it out. Over 15 minutes, restart the indexer pod on the Duskvale cluster; it catches up fast. Don't touch the retention job while the indexer is behind, that's how we got the gap last quarter. Step-by-step restart instructions and the escalation rota are on the page below.

runbook for yafof-kahif: https://jira.qorvelsys.internal/browse/display/pages/browse/0c52